Conservatives call on Carney not to ‘stack the deck’ by using majority to shut opposition out of committees

National Post: “We are in unprecedented territory,” Scheer said, referring to how the Carney government elevated its status to majority from minority on Monday, thanks to three byelection wins but in large part because of five MPs crossing the floor, four of which came from the Conservatives and one from the New Democrats.

He called on the majority Liberals to “uphold the tradition” that the makeup of committees be decided by the outcome of the last election…
